Viscosity measures a fluid's resistance to flow. Dynamic viscosity (Pa·s or cP) measures shear resistance. Kinematic viscosity (m²/s or cSt) = dynamic / density. Water at 20°C ≈ 1 cP.

Wzór

1 Poise = 0.1 Pa·s | 1 centipoise (cP) = 0.001 Pa·s | Kinematic: 1 Stoke = 0.0001 m²/s

  1. 1Dynamic: Pa·s (SI) or centipoise (1 cP = 1 mPa·s)
  2. 2Kinematic: m²/s (SI) or centistoke (1 cSt = 1 mm²/s)
  3. 31 Pa·s = 1,000 cP
  4. 4Kinematic viscosity = Dynamic / Density

Water at 20°C
Wynik
Dynamic: ~1 mPa·s (1 cP); Kinematic: ~1 mm²/s (1 cSt)
